Career Highlights

Completing the LLDD Bedford College project on time and within budget with the added challenges of an additional £1m being added to the contract value part way through the programme. Social value played a key part to this project with regular safe guided site tours for students, live training areas for the college’s construction pupils, an on-site BBQ and numerous work experience weeks and apprentices on site. The project received a National Silver CCS Award for achieving 43 out of 50, Ashe’s highest score at the time.
